About Land.com:

CoStar is the owner of Land.com, LandWatch, Land and Farm, and AcreValue and is the leading operator of online marketplaces that support the sale and purchase of farms, ranches, country homes, and rural land. Our customers include real-estate brokers, real-estate agents, owners, and investors who need internet listing services and information to help them sell/purchase properties and track competitive trends.

About the Role:

The Land team is seeking a full-time Software Engineer to develop and maintain new systems and implement improvements to existing systems and processes.  As an ideal candidate, you will have multiple years of experience developing and maintaining highly performant web applications that will be beneficial in driving the growth of our Land business unit. 

This position is located in Austin, TX and offers a schedule of Monday to Thursday in the office and the option to work from home on Friday.

Responsibilities:

  • Maintain and improve existing systems
  • Develop and maintain database design and SQL scripts
  • Apply software design patterns, sound quality management methods, tools, and techniques to create and support defect-free application software that meets the needs of the organization with high reusability and maintainability
  • Leverage AI-Assisted development tool to accelerate implementation, refactoring, and test creation, while ensuring correctness, security, and maintainability through strong engineering judgment.
  • Write thorough unit tests to ensure the quality of the software you own

Basic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or related field from an accredited, not-for-profit, in-person college/university
  • A track record of commitment to prior employers.
  • 3+ years of development experience in production environment
  • Strong proficiency using C#, .NET Development
  • Deep understanding and experience using SQL
  • Experience with software testing (Unit, Integration, Functional, Performance)
  • String grasp of AI-assisted coding tools (e.g. Microsoft CoPilot or similar) to improve developer productivity
  • Experience working within an Agile team environment
  • Understanding and knowledge of SOLID principles and design patterns
  • Ability to clearly communicate thoughts and ideas within and across teams
  • Ability to work well with other developers and management

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Experience with Visual Studio, SSMS, and Azure DevOps or Git
  • Experience with AWS and OpenSearch/Elasticsearch
  • Experience architecting systems using C#, .NET Development.
